Binder-Free Innovation
Our GUJWOOL™ series is manufactured using a mechanical bonding process that eliminates chemical binders. This ensures our products are non-combustible and produce low smoke or toxic emissions during high-temperature exposure.
Custom Engineering
We offer advanced post-production capabilities including die cutting, CNC profiling, and multi-layer lamination to meet precise project blueprints .
Material Versatility
From standard E-Glass to high-purity Silica (≥96% SiO₂), we manipulate fibre chemistry to provide resistance to temperatures reaching 1000°C.
